*Name:* Multiple problems in Ethereal 0.10.4 *Docid:* enpa-sa-00015 *Date:* July 6, 2004 *Versions affected:* 0.8.15 up to and including 0.10.4 *Severity:* *High* Details *Description:* Issues have been discovered in the following protocol dissectors: * The iSNS dissector could make Ethereal abort in some cases. (0.10.3 - 0.10.4) CAN-2004-0633 * SMB SID snooping could crash if there was no policy name for a handle. (0.9.15 - 0.10.4) CAN-2004-0634 * The SNMP dissector could crash due to a malformed or missing community string. (0.8.15 - 0.10.4) CAN-2004-0635 *Impact:* It may be possible to make Ethereal crash or run arbitrary code by injecting a purposefully malformed packet onto the wire or by convincing someone to read a malformed packet trace file. *Resolution:* Upgrade to 0.10.5. If you are running a version prior to 0.10.5 and you cannot upgrade, you can disable all of the protocol dissectors listed above by selecting /Analyze->Enabled Protocols.../ and deselecting them from the list. For SMB, you can alternatively disable SID snooping in the SMB protocol preferences. However, it is strongly recommended that you upgrade to 0.10.5.
